打印

研究所里悬而未决的FPGA问题

[复制链接]
2053|15
手机看帖
扫描二维码
随时随地手机跟帖
跳转到指定楼层
楼主
longfei3707|  楼主 | 2013-2-2 20:42 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
采用altera的EP2C8,嵌入一个NIOS II作为主控,编译通过后将程序烧写到EPCS中,奇怪的现象出现了,如果USB_Blaster带电插在JTAG口上,则串口模块可以正常工作,但是如果把下载器拔掉,串口模块发送和接收都不好使了,让人很疑惑,问了好多人都没遇到过,请问大家有碰到这个情况的么,交流一下心得体会。:P

相关帖子

沙发
forrest11| | 2013-2-2 20:54 | 只看该作者
你的“地”有问题。

使用特权

评论回复
板凳
shiyan1532| | 2013-2-2 21:01 | 只看该作者
帮顶

使用特权

评论回复
地板
longfei3707|  楼主 | 2013-2-2 21:09 | 只看该作者
forrest11 发表于 2013-2-2 20:54
你的“地”有问题。

我也这么想过,但是那个画硬件的工程师**说是我程序的问题,让他看程序,他却不搭理我,有点小郁闷。

使用特权

评论回复
5
forrest11| | 2013-2-2 23:26 | 只看该作者
longfei3707 发表于 2013-2-2 21:09
我也这么想过,但是那个画硬件的工程师**说是我程序的问题,让他看程序,他却不搭理我,有点小郁闷。 ...

软件本身应该没有问题。要有问题,也是配置不对导致,但这种情况应该是软件完全没有跑起来,而不是部分功能不正确。
直接量接口信号即可。

使用特权

评论回复
6
hys0401| | 2013-2-3 15:10 | 只看该作者
NIOS II软核有时候有点怪。我有次用IO模拟SPI接口,死活工作不正常。用逻辑分析仪抓了下时序,我的天,大部分是对的,一部分有明显错误……一怒之下重建整个工程,包括SOPC部分的;然后代码部分,包括C语言部分完全没有修改过;重建工程后就工作正常了,用逻辑分析仪抓时序也完全正常。
楼主这种情况倒是真心没见过.

使用特权

评论回复
7
tanliming007| | 2013-2-3 18:04 | 只看该作者
围观学习

使用特权

评论回复
8
longfei3707|  楼主 | 2013-2-18 16:27 | 只看该作者
forrest11 发表于 2013-2-2 23:26
软件本身应该没有问题。要有问题,也是配置不对导致,但这种情况应该是软件完全没有跑起来,而不是部分功 ...

用逻辑分析仪看了下,通信的协议没有问题,软件也测试了,能跑起来,无奈又被说成是程序的问题,我决定今天去检查一下他设计的硬件。

使用特权

评论回复
9
longfei3707|  楼主 | 2013-2-18 16:29 | 只看该作者
hys0401 发表于 2013-2-3 15:10
NIOS II软核有时候有点怪。我有次用IO模拟SPI接口,死活工作不正常。用逻辑分析仪抓了下时序,我的天,大部分 ...

这个也试过了,重新建立工程,包括SOPC,甚至连输入法的问题都想过,但是还是不行,今天想去查一下硬件。

使用特权

评论回复
10
longfei3707|  楼主 | 2013-2-18 16:30 | 只看该作者
kaiseradler 发表于 2013-2-3 18:08
你加一个stp看看,看看程序有没有跑起来

程序是跑起来了,就是通信还是不好使,今天准备查一下硬件。

使用特权

评论回复
11
summerxue| | 2013-2-18 19:21 | 只看该作者
2楼说的对,是共地的问题,要把串口接口的“地”和板子的“地”连接在一起。

使用特权

评论回复
12
CrazyWill| | 2013-2-19 13:48 | 只看该作者
地 嫌疑较大
量测串口RX TX信号有否?幅值是否正常?

使用特权

评论回复
13
longfei3707|  楼主 | 2013-3-12 13:58 | 只看该作者
summerxue 发表于 2013-2-18 19:21
2楼说的对,是共地的问题,要把串口接口的“地”和板子的“地”连接在一起。 ...

没错,是地的问题,硬件工程师给我们的串口线是自己设计的屏蔽线,其中的地线的线序弄错了,两者的地没有连通,造成这个问题,现在他没话可说了。

使用特权

评论回复
14
longfei3707|  楼主 | 2013-3-12 13:59 | 只看该作者
CrazyWill 发表于 2013-2-19 13:48
地 嫌疑较大
量测串口RX TX信号有否?幅值是否正常?

确实是地,地线没有连接,在硬件工程师的固执下我们浪费了好长时间。

使用特权

评论回复
15
chinaitboy| | 2013-3-12 14:17 | 只看该作者
确认一下复位初始化是否正常

使用特权

评论回复
16
GoldSunMonkey| | 2013-3-12 21:55 | 只看该作者
chinaitboy 发表于 2013-3-12 14:17
确认一下复位初始化是否正常

别人解决了

使用特权

评论回复
发新帖 我要提问
您需要登录后才可以回帖 登录 | 注册

本版积分规则

个人签名:何惧天高~~~

3

主题

28

帖子

2

粉丝